We're excited to announce that not one, but TWO additions to the Parks, Recreation and Open Space family! A bouncing baby ram (boy lamb) was born on June 28 at the Plains Conservation Center, followed by a half-sister (ewe lamb) on July 13! Paco and Maria, the resident donkeys who watch over all the sheep and keep coyotes at bay, were especially protective of the new arrivals. Both moms and babies are doing well at their home pastures at Willow Creek Pastures.

Beck Preschool was recently awarded a Level Four rating (out of five levels) from the Colorado Shines Quality Rating and Improvement System which means the service offered here is remarkable! The system measures overall school quality of licensed early care and learning programs throughout the state. Congratulations to the Beck Preschool Team!
